The structure of an iron porphyrin with dichlorocarbene as ligand has now been estabished by X‐ray analysis. The complex (1) accordingly contains a planar Fe(TPP)skeleton with H 2 O and CCl 2 as axial ligands. The structural unit (2) is almost linear.
